Rauh- und Schneidvorrichtung für LuftschläucheRaising and cutting device for air hoses
Die Erfindung betrifft eine Rauh- und Schneidvorrichtung für iuftschläuche, insbesondere für Fahrradreifen, zum Einschneiden eines Ventilloches und Aufrauhen der Umgebungsfläche.The invention relates to a roughening and cutting device for air hoses, especially for bicycle tires, for cutting a valve hole and roughening the surrounding area.
Bei Fahrradschläuchen mit anvulkanisierten Gummifußventilen war es bisher üblich, Schlauch und Gummifuß des Ventils im noch unvulkanisierten Zustand zusammenzubringen und gemeinsam auszuvulkanisieren.It was the case with bicycle tubes with vulcanized rubber foot valves Previously common, the hose and rubber base of the valve were still unvulcanized bring together and vulcanize out together.
Bei einer Scblauchfertigung, bei der Schlauch endlos auf einem Extruder gespritzt und anschließend kontinuierlich, beispielsweise im Salzbar vulkanisiert wird, um anschließend auf Fertigmaßabschnitte zugeschnitten und konfektioniert zu werden,ergeben sich jedoch Schwierigkeiten um eine feste Verbindung zwischen dem Gummifußventil und dem bereits ausvulkanisierten Schlauch zu erreichen, da ein herkömmliches Aufkleben mit einer entsprechenden Gummi lösung nicht die erforderliche Dauerfestigkeit bringt.In the case of hose production, where the hose is endlessly on an extruder injected and then continuously vulcanized, for example in a salt bar is then cut to finished size sections and assembled are, however, difficulties arise in order to establish a permanent connection between the Rubber foot valve and the already vulcanized hose, as a conventional one Gluing with an appropriate rubber solution does not have the required fatigue strength brings.
Bei einem derartigen Herstellungsverfahren ist es daher erforderlich, an der Aufsatzstelle des Gummifußventi-ls ein entsprechendes Ventilloch in eine Wandung des Schlauches zu schneiden und die Umgebung dieses Ventilloches für das Anvulkanisieren des Gummifuflventils entsprechend aufzurauhen.In such a manufacturing process, it is therefore necessary at the attachment point of the rubber foot valve, insert a corresponding valve hole into a To cut the wall of the hose and the area around this valve hole for the Roughen the vulcanization of the rubber fill valve accordingly.
Der Erfindung liegt daher die Aufgabe zugrunde, eine Vorrichtung zu schaffen mit der es möglich ist, das Aufrauhen des Schlauches und das Einschneiden des Ventiles in ein und demselben Arbeitsgang durchzuführen.The invention is therefore based on the object of providing a device create with which it is possible to roughen the hose and cut it of the valve in one and the same work step.
Zur Lösung dieser Aufgabe ist erfindungsgemäß vorgesehen, daß eine auf dem in einer Halterung liegenden flachen Schlauch absenkbare, kreisförmige Rauhscheibe vorgesehen ist, die in ihrem Zentrum einen nach unten herausragenden Schneidansatz mit einer Höhe entsprechend der Dicke der Schlauchwandung zum Einschneiden des Ventilloches trägt.To solve this problem, the invention provides that a Circular buffing disc that can be lowered onto the flat hose in a holder is provided, which has a downwardly protruding cutting attachment in its center with a height corresponding to the thickness of the hose wall for cutting the valve hole wearing.
Damit ist es auf einfache Weise möglich, an einer beliebigen Stelle des Schlauchumfangs ein Ventilloch nur einseitig in den Schlauch zu schneiden.This makes it possible in a simple way, at any point around the circumference of the hose to cut a valve hole in the hose only on one side.
Anhand einer schematischen Zeichnung sind Aufbau und Wirkungsweise eines Ausführungsbeispiels nach der Erfindung näher erläutert. Dabei zeigen: Fig. 1 eine schematische Seitenansicht einer Rauh-und Schneidvorrichtung für das Ventilloch, Fig. 2 einen Längsschnitt durch einen Schlauchabschnitt im Fertigzustand im Bereich des Ventilloches und Fig. 3 eine Aufsicht auf diesen Schlauchabschnitt mit der aufgerauhten Stelle und dem Ventilloch.A schematic drawing shows the structure and mode of operation an embodiment according to the invention explained in more detail. They show: Fig. 1 a schematic side view of a roughening and cutting device for the valve hole, 2 shows a longitudinal section through a tube section in the finished state in the area of the valve hole and FIG. 3 shows a plan view of this hose section with the roughened one Place and the valve hole.
Wie aus Fig. 1 zu ersehen ist, wird auf eine flache Halterung 1 mit zwei Anschlägen 2 und 3 an der hinteren Kante der Halterung 1 ein Schlauch 4 mit Schlauchoberseite 5 und Schlauchunterseite 6 im praktisch luft losen Zustand so aufgelegt, daß er bündig an die beiden Anschläge 2 und 3 anliegt. Die korrekte Lage des Schlauches wird dabei durch zwei Photozellen 7 und 8 überwacht.As can be seen from Fig. 1, is on a flat bracket 1 with two stops 2 and 3 on the rear Edge of bracket 1 Hose 4 with hose top 5 and hose bottom 6 in practically airless State placed in such a way that it is flush with the two stops 2 and 3. the The correct position of the hose is monitored by two photocells 7 and 8.
Oberhalb des so in Position gebrachten Schlauches 1 ist nunmehr eine ebene, kreisförmige Rauhscheibe 9 über einen Stempel 10 absenkbar gehalten, die die Schlauchoberseite 5 im Bereich des aufzubringenden Gummifußventils aufrauht. Gleichzeitig trägt diese Rauhscheibe 9 im Zentrum einen Schneidansatz 11, der maximal die Höhe entsprechend der Dicke der oberen Schlauchwandung 5 aufweist. Nach Absenken der Rauhscheibe 9 wird somit ein Ventilloch geschnitten und die Schlauchoberseite 2 entsprechend aufgerauht.Above the thus brought into position hose 1 is now a flat, circular roughing disc 9 held lowerable via a punch 10, the roughening the upper side of the hose 5 in the area of the rubber foot valve to be applied. At the same time, this rough wheel 9 has a cutting attachment 11 in the center, the maximum has the height corresponding to the thickness of the upper hose wall 5. After lowering the roughing disk 9 is thus cut a valve hole and the upper side of the tube 2 roughened accordingly.
Der fertiqe Schlauchabschnitt ist in den Fig. 2 und 3 gezeigt. Dabei erkennt man das in die Schlauchoberseite 5 eingeschnittene Ventilloch 12 sowie den kreisförmig aufgerauhten Bereich 13 in der Umgebung des Ventilloches 12,auf den anschließend das eigentliche Gummifußventil 14 mit seiner Unterseite 15 aufgesetzt und anvulkanisiert wird.The finished tube section is shown in FIGS. Included one recognizes the valve hole 12 cut into the tube top 5 as well as the circular roughened area 13 in the vicinity of the valve hole 12 on the then the actual rubber foot valve 14 is placed with its underside 15 and vulcanized.
Mit der beschriebenen Vorrichtung ist es also auf einfache Weise möglich, in einem einzigen Arbeitsgang bei aufeinanderliegendem Schlauch ein Ventilloch in nur eine Wandung des Schlauches einzuschneiden und gleichzeitig die Umgebung des Ventilloches aufzurauhen.With the device described, it is therefore possible in a simple manner a valve hole in a single operation with the hose lying on top of one another to cut only one wall of the hose and at the same time the area around the Roughen valve holes.
